He has previously said he followed an intermittent fasting regime to lose eight pounds in less than a week.

Hugh Fearnley Whittingstall lost more than half a stone in six days following the Fast Diet

This is a regime, also known as the Fast Diet or 5 2 Diet, whereby slimmers eat less on two days of the week.

For instance, they eat normally for five days, but reduce their calories to 600 for a man (500 for a woman) on two days.

Hugh initially piled on the pounds during a tricky Christmas period, he told Daily Mail in 2013.

“At the turn of the year, like so many, I consumed way too much meat, cheese, cream, sugar and alcohol.

“And despite a garden bursting with brussel sprouts, kale and winter salads, and a weekly delivery of organic apples, oranges, clementines and bananas, I know I didn’t eat nearly enough fruit and veg to offset the gluttony.”

He found changing his body “exhilarating”, he told the publication.

“I’ve lost eight pounds already, and I find the whole thing rather exhilarating.

“I feel I might just be part of a health revolution,” he added.

On his new three part documentary, Britain’s Fat Fight, Hugh will be exploring Britain’s status at the most obese country in Western Europe.

He will investigate what is causing this obesity and the associated health problems.
